10 years of comfort and elegance – I purchased my Concerto lounge suite from King furniture in January 2011. I’m really happy with it. It’s very comfortable and spacious and shows no sign of ageing. I recently had to have it recovered because the fabric was accidentally sprayed with bleach. The reupholstering process took awhile but I’m very happy with the results. I chose the Positano Ruby fabric which I love. Very expensive but it is stunning and looks like it will wear well. All and all I’m very happy with my Concerto lounge suite.
Purchased in at King Living QLD, Gold Coast for $5,210.

Most uncomfortable sofa – We bought a Concerto sofa from King Furniture two and a half years ago. It seemed comfortable in the show room, but I guess you get seduced. It is like sitting on a park bench! It is so hard and uncomfortable and the seat is too deep for me as I am not tall. We had to buy two more cushions for my back but the couch is as hard as a rock. I phoned King Furniture and they were not in the least bit interested. In fact the manager of Annandale said they were having a sale soon, perhaps I would like to buy another one. Never again !
